From: Peter Tyser <ptyser@xes-inc.com> To: linuxppc-dev@ozlabs.org Cc: linux-kbuild@vger.kernel.org, Peter Tyser <ptyser@xes-inc.com> Subject: [PATCH v2 1/3] powerpc: Use scripts/mkuboot.sh instead of 'mkimage' Date: Mon, 21 Dec 2009 19:50:41 -0600 [thread overview] Message-ID: <1261446643-21714-2-git-send-email-ptyser@xes-inc.com> (raw) In-Reply-To: <1261446643-21714-1-git-send-email-ptyser@xes-inc.com> mkuboot.sh provides a basic wrapper for the 'mkimage' utility. Using mkuboot.sh provides clearer error reporting and allows a toolchain to use its own 'mkimage' executable specified by ${CROSS_COMPILE}mkimage. Additionally, this brings PowerPC in line with other architectures which already call mkimage via mkuboot.sh. Signed-off-by: Peter Tyser <ptyser@xes-inc.com> --- arch/powerpc/boot/wrapper | 7 +++++-- 1 files changed, 5 insertions(+), 2 deletions(-) diff --git a/arch/powerpc/boot/wrapper b/arch/powerpc/boot/wrapper index 390512a..f4594ed 100755 --- a/arch/powerpc/boot/wrapper +++ b/arch/powerpc/boot/wrapper @@ -43,6 +43,9 @@ gzip=.gz # cross-compilation prefix CROSS= +# mkimage wrapper script +MKIMAGE=$srctree/scripts/mkuboot.sh + # directory for object and other files used by this script object=arch/powerpc/boot objbin=$object @@ -267,7 +270,7 @@ membase=`${CROSS}objdump -p "$kernel" | grep -m 1 LOAD | awk '{print $7}'` case "$platform" in uboot) rm -f "$ofile" - mkimage -A ppc -O linux -T kernel -C gzip -a $membase -e $membase \ + ${MKIMAGE} -A ppc -O linux -T kernel -C gzip -a $membase -e $membase \ $uboot_version -d "$vmz" "$ofile" if [ -z "$cacheit" ]; then rm -f "$vmz" @@ -327,7 +330,7 @@ coff) ;; cuboot*) gzip -f -9 "$ofile" - mkimage -A ppc -O linux -T kernel -C gzip -a "$base" -e "$entry" \ + ${MKIMAGE} -A ppc -O linux -T kernel -C gzip -a "$base" -e "$entry" \ $uboot_version -d "$ofile".gz "$ofile" ;; treeboot*) -- 1.6.2.1
WARNING: multiple messages have this Message-ID (diff)
From: Peter Tyser <ptyser@xes-inc.com> To: linuxppc-dev@ozlabs.org Cc: Peter Tyser <ptyser@xes-inc.com>, linux-kbuild@vger.kernel.org Subject: [PATCH v2 1/3] powerpc: Use scripts/mkuboot.sh instead of 'mkimage' Date: Mon, 21 Dec 2009 19:50:41 -0600 [thread overview] Message-ID: <1261446643-21714-2-git-send-email-ptyser@xes-inc.com> (raw) In-Reply-To: <1261446643-21714-1-git-send-email-ptyser@xes-inc.com> mkuboot.sh provides a basic wrapper for the 'mkimage' utility. Using mkuboot.sh provides clearer error reporting and allows a toolchain to use its own 'mkimage' executable specified by ${CROSS_COMPILE}mkimage. Additionally, this brings PowerPC in line with other architectures which already call mkimage via mkuboot.sh. Signed-off-by: Peter Tyser <ptyser@xes-inc.com> --- arch/powerpc/boot/wrapper | 7 +++++-- 1 files changed, 5 insertions(+), 2 deletions(-) diff --git a/arch/powerpc/boot/wrapper b/arch/powerpc/boot/wrapper index 390512a..f4594ed 100755 --- a/arch/powerpc/boot/wrapper +++ b/arch/powerpc/boot/wrapper @@ -43,6 +43,9 @@ gzip=.gz # cross-compilation prefix CROSS= +# mkimage wrapper script +MKIMAGE=$srctree/scripts/mkuboot.sh + # directory for object and other files used by this script object=arch/powerpc/boot objbin=$object @@ -267,7 +270,7 @@ membase=`${CROSS}objdump -p "$kernel" | grep -m 1 LOAD | awk '{print $7}'` case "$platform" in uboot) rm -f "$ofile" - mkimage -A ppc -O linux -T kernel -C gzip -a $membase -e $membase \ + ${MKIMAGE} -A ppc -O linux -T kernel -C gzip -a $membase -e $membase \ $uboot_version -d "$vmz" "$ofile" if [ -z "$cacheit" ]; then rm -f "$vmz" @@ -327,7 +330,7 @@ coff) ;; cuboot*) gzip -f -9 "$ofile" - mkimage -A ppc -O linux -T kernel -C gzip -a "$base" -e "$entry" \ + ${MKIMAGE} -A ppc -O linux -T kernel -C gzip -a "$base" -e "$entry" \ $uboot_version -d "$ofile".gz "$ofile" ;; treeboot*) -- 1.6.2.1
next prev parent reply other threads:[~2009-12-22 1:50 UTC|newest] Thread overview: 75+ messages / expand[flat|nested] mbox.gz Atom feed top 2009-12-22 1:50 [PATCH v2 0/3] powerpc: Add support for FIT uImages Peter Tyser 2009-12-22 1:50 ` Peter Tyser 2009-12-22 1:50 ` Peter Tyser [this message] 2009-12-22 1:50 ` [PATCH v2 1/3] powerpc: Use scripts/mkuboot.sh instead of 'mkimage' Peter Tyser 2009-12-30 22:25 ` Grant Likely 2009-12-30 22:25 ` Grant Likely 2009-12-22 1:50 ` [PATCH v2 2/3] powerpc: Add support for creating FIT uImages Peter Tyser 2009-12-22 1:50 ` Peter Tyser 2009-12-22 3:48 ` Olof Johansson 2009-12-22 4:50 ` Peter Tyser 2009-12-30 22:57 ` Grant Likely 2009-12-30 22:57 ` Grant Likely 2010-01-01 14:18 ` Wolfgang Denk 2010-01-01 14:18 ` Wolfgang Denk 2010-01-03 5:23 ` Grant Likely 2010-01-03 5:23 ` Grant Likely 2009-12-22 1:50 ` [PATCH v2 3/3] powerpc: Add support for ram filesystems in " Peter Tyser 2009-12-22 1:50 ` Peter Tyser 2009-12-30 23:02 ` Grant Likely 2009-12-30 23:02 ` Grant Likely 2009-12-30 23:39 ` Peter Tyser 2009-12-30 23:39 ` [U-Boot] " Peter Tyser 2009-12-30 23:39 ` Peter Tyser 2009-12-31 0:01 ` Grant Likely 2009-12-31 0:01 ` [U-Boot] " Grant Likely 2009-12-31 0:01 ` Grant Likely 2009-12-31 1:10 ` Peter Tyser 2009-12-31 1:10 ` [U-Boot] " Peter Tyser 2009-12-31 1:10 ` Peter Tyser 2010-01-03 5:08 ` [U-Boot] " Grant Likely 2010-01-03 5:08 ` Grant Likely 2010-01-03 5:08 ` Grant Likely 2010-01-03 10:10 ` Wolfgang Denk 2010-01-03 10:10 ` Wolfgang Denk 2010-01-03 10:10 ` Wolfgang Denk 2010-01-04 1:07 ` Peter Tyser 2010-01-04 1:07 ` Peter Tyser 2010-01-04 1:07 ` Peter Tyser 2010-01-04 8:27 ` Grant Likely 2010-01-04 8:27 ` Grant Likely 2010-01-04 8:27 ` Grant Likely 2009-12-31 8:01 ` Peter Korsgaard 2009-12-31 8:01 ` [U-Boot] " Peter Korsgaard 2009-12-31 8:01 ` Peter Korsgaard 2010-01-01 14:12 ` Wolfgang Denk 2010-01-01 14:12 ` [U-Boot] " Wolfgang Denk 2010-01-01 14:12 ` Wolfgang Denk 2010-01-03 5:18 ` Grant Likely 2010-01-03 5:18 ` [U-Boot] " Grant Likely 2010-01-03 5:18 ` Grant Likely 2010-01-03 10:15 ` Wolfgang Denk 2010-01-03 10:15 ` [U-Boot] " Wolfgang Denk 2010-01-03 10:15 ` Wolfgang Denk 2009-12-31 22:44 ` Wolfgang Denk 2009-12-31 22:44 ` Wolfgang Denk 2009-12-31 23:10 ` Peter Tyser 2009-12-31 23:10 ` Peter Tyser 2010-01-01 10:44 ` Wolfgang Denk 2010-01-01 10:44 ` Wolfgang Denk 2010-01-03 5:13 ` Grant Likely 2010-01-03 5:13 ` Grant Likely 2010-01-03 10:12 ` Wolfgang Denk 2010-01-03 10:12 ` Wolfgang Denk 2010-01-03 8:06 ` Peter Korsgaard 2010-01-03 8:06 ` Peter Korsgaard 2010-01-03 9:50 ` Wolfgang Denk 2010-01-03 9:50 ` Wolfgang Denk 2010-01-03 14:27 ` Peter Korsgaard 2010-01-03 14:27 ` Peter Korsgaard 2010-01-04 8:34 ` Grant Likely 2010-01-04 8:34 ` Grant Likely 2010-01-03 23:52 ` Peter Tyser 2010-01-03 23:52 ` Peter Tyser 2010-01-03 5:10 ` Grant Likely 2010-01-03 5:10 ` Grant Likely
Reply instructions: You may reply publicly to this message via plain-text email using any one of the following methods: * Save the following mbox file, import it into your mail client, and reply-to-all from there: mbox Avoid top-posting and favor interleaved quoting: https://en.wikipedia.org/wiki/Posting_style#Interleaved_style * Reply using the --to, --cc, and --in-reply-to switches of git-send-email(1): git send-email \ --in-reply-to=1261446643-21714-2-git-send-email-ptyser@xes-inc.com \ --to=ptyser@xes-inc.com \ --cc=linux-kbuild@vger.kernel.org \ --cc=linuxppc-dev@ozlabs.org \ /path/to/YOUR_REPLY https://kernel.org/pub/software/scm/git/docs/git-send-email.html * If your mail client supports setting the In-Reply-To header via mailto: links, try the mailto: linkBe s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es, see mirroring instructions on how to clone and mirror all data and code used by this external index.